Transaction 869cb76b97c5b2a140b6e2c8cd7b0d201f3014b97e0c6b2ff62e1374e0af171b

1 Input
1 Outputs
  • 869cb76b97c5b2a140b6e2c8cd7b0d201f3014b97e0c6b2ff62e1374e0af171b:0
  • value  23554032
    address  145BRUkViUpGfg5fVzuWMM3tWV9FVNrR8i